The “Netflix Household” feature defines a group of devices connected to the internet at a single primary location that can access Netflix. It’s intended to ensure that accounts are not shared between different residences. Addressing the configuration associated with a defined group of devices is a process some users may need to understand. For instance, subscribers moving to a new residence or wanting to restrict access to their account from specific devices will need to be familiar with this procedure.
Managing a Netflix Household is crucial for maintaining account security and adhering to the platform’s terms of service. This helps to prevent unauthorized access and potential misuse of the account. Prior to its introduction, widespread password sharing occurred, impacting Netflix’s revenue streams. The implementation of this feature sought to address this issue and encourage users to subscribe to appropriate plans based on their usage needs.
